Pyramids of Euseigne (3)

The vibrations from road traffic just below the pyramids obviously risked destabilising and causing these fragile ‘fairy chimneys’ to collapse. A 120-metre-long tunnel was dug with great care a short distance away from the site, which has been pedestrianised and equipped with picnic tables and large educational panels presenting the fauna of the Alps.
